首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

以编程方式使用图像作为背景的C# WPF MenuItem

C# WPF MenuItem是Windows Presentation Foundation (WPF)框架中的一个控件,用于创建菜单项。它可以用于创建具有图像背景的菜单项,以增强用户界面的可视化效果。

在C# WPF中,可以通过编程方式使用图像作为MenuItem的背景。以下是实现此目的的步骤:

  1. 准备图像资源:首先,您需要准备一个图像文件,可以是常见的图像格式(如PNG、JPEG等)。确保将图像文件添加到您的项目资源中。
  2. 创建MenuItem:在XAML或代码中创建一个MenuItem控件,并设置其内容和命令等属性。
  3. 设置背景图像:使用MenuItem的样式或模板,将图像作为背景设置。您可以使用ImageBrush来实现这一点。以下是一个示例代码片段,展示了如何设置MenuItem的背景图像:
代码语言:txt
复制
// 创建MenuItem
MenuItem menuItem = new MenuItem();
menuItem.Header = "菜单项";

// 设置背景图像
ImageBrush imageBrush = new ImageBrush();
imageBrush.ImageSource = new BitmapImage(new Uri("图像文件路径"));
menuItem.Background = imageBrush;

在上面的代码中,您需要将"图像文件路径"替换为您实际图像文件的路径。

  1. 添加事件处理程序:如果需要,您可以为MenuItem添加点击事件处理程序,以便在用户单击菜单项时执行特定的操作。

至于腾讯云相关产品和产品介绍链接地址,很遗憾,我无法提供直接的链接。但是,腾讯云提供了丰富的云计算服务,您可以访问腾讯云官方网站,浏览他们的产品文档和服务列表,以找到适合您需求的产品。

总结:C# WPF MenuItem是用于创建菜单项的控件,可以通过编程方式使用图像作为其背景。通过设置MenuItem的背景为图像,可以增强用户界面的可视化效果。腾讯云提供了各种云计算服务,可以满足不同的需求,您可以访问腾讯云官方网站以获取更多信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分12秒

企业如何应用零信任iOA保障办公安全

1分21秒

JSP博客管理系统myeclipse开发mysql数据库mvc结构java编程

16分8秒

人工智能新途-用路由器集群模仿神经元集群

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

领券